If you've recently purchased a Cisco IDS/IPS appliance, it should have included a CD-ROM containing VMS Basic.
This is a version of VMS that is restricted to only five IDS/IPS sensors. Otherwise, it is the same as VMS.
In effect, this could be considered an evaluation copy, though it is more than sufficient in environments where you won't have to worry about managing more than five sensors...

You can download a fuly working version of Ciscoworks VMS from the CCO website (provided you have a valid CCO account). This is the same as the version they sell, except the trail key times out after 90 days. You can't re-install it on the same server without reloading the OS.
VMS and IEV are similar, but definately NOT the same thing.
